The Art of Oratory: A Look into the History and Techniques of Public Speaking

Orating refers to the act of speaking in public, especially in a formal or official setting. It can also refer to the art of public speaking, including the use of rhetorical devices and techniques to persuade or inform an audience.

In ancient Rome, oratory was considered an important skill for politicians and lawyers, and there were many famous orators who were known for their eloquence and persuasive abilities. The word "oratory" comes from the Latin word "orare," which means "to speak."
